Skip to content

Commit

Permalink
Update attributes.json (#574)
Browse files Browse the repository at this point in the history
* Update attributes.json

reviewed descriptions of the attributes

* Update attributes.json

Problematische quotes eruit gehaald.

* Update attributes.json

checked html code.

* Update attributes.json

another revision

* Update attributes.json

i
  • Loading branch information
teunfransen authored and MKodde committed Jan 23, 2023
1 parent b049682 commit 1734b96
Showing 1 changed file with 54 additions and 69 deletions.
123 changes: 54 additions & 69 deletions app/config/attributes.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,9 +4,9 @@
"translations" : {
"en": {
"saml20Label": "Given name att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Given name att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>urn:mace schema: <a href='https://wiki.refeds.org/display/STAN/eduPerson+2021-11' target='_blank'>urn:mace:dir:attribute-def:givenName</a><br />urn:oid schema: <a href='http://oid-info.com/get/2.5.4.42' target='_blank'>urn:oid:2.5.4.42</a> </p> <p>Description: Given name, also known as a first name, forename or Christian name / name known by; combinations of title, initials, and name known by are possible.</p>",
"oidcngLabel": "given_name",
"oidcngInfo": "<p>given_name</p> <p>Description: given name, also known as a first name, forename or Christian name / name known by; combinations of title, initials, and name known by are possible.</p>"
}
},
"urns": [
Expand All @@ -18,10 +18,10 @@
"id": "surName",
"translations" : {
"en": {
"saml20Label": "Sur name att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Sur name att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Label": "Surname attribute",
"saml20Info": "<p>urn:mace: <a href='https://wiki.refeds.org/display/STAN/eduPerson+2021-11' target='_blank'>urn:mace:dir:attribute-def:sn</a><br /><a href='http://oid-info.com/get/2.5.4.4' target='_blank'> urn:oid: urn:oid:2.5.4.4 </a></p> <p>Description: The surname of a person (including any words such as &quot;van&quot;, &quot;de&quot;, &quot;von&quot; etc.) used for personalization; this can be a combination of existing attributes.</p>",
"oidcngLabel": "family_name",
"oidcngInfo": "<p>family_name</p> <p>Description: The surname of a person (including any words such as &quot;van&quot;, &quot;de&quot;, &quot;von&quot; etc.) used for personalization; this can be a combination of existing attributes.</p>"
}
},
"urns": [
Expand All @@ -34,9 +34,9 @@
"translations" : {
"en": {
"saml20Label": "Common name att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Common name att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>urn:mace: <a href='https://wiki.refeds.org/display/STAN/eduPerson+2021-11' target='_blank'>urn:mace:dir:attribute-def:cn</a><br />urn:oid: <a href='http://oid-info.com/get/2.5.4.3' target='_blank'>urn:oid:2.5.4.3</a></p> <p>Description: full name.</p>",
"oidcngLabel": "name",
"oidcngInfo": "<p>name</p><p>Description: full name.</p>"
}
},
"urns": [
Expand All @@ -49,9 +49,9 @@
"translations" : {
"en": {
"saml20Label": "Display name att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Display name att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>urn:mace: <a title='https://wiki.refeds.org/display/STAN/eduPerson+2021-11' href='https://wiki.refeds.org/display/STAN/eduPerson+2021-11' target='_blank'>urn:mace:dir:attribute-def:displayName</a><br />urn:oid: <a href='http://oid-info.com/cgi-bin/display?oid=2.16.840.1.113730.3.1.241&amp;action=display' target='_blank'>urn:oid:2.16.840.1.113730.3.1.241</a></p> <p>Description: name as displayed in applications.</p>",
"oidcngLabel": "nickname",
"oidcngInfo": "<p>nickname</p> <p>Description: name as displayed in applications.</p>"
}
},
"urns": [
Expand All @@ -64,9 +64,9 @@
"translations" : {
"en": {
"saml20Label": "Email address att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Email address att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>email</p> <p>Description: e-mail address; syntax in accordance with RFC 5322.</p>",
"oidcngLabel": "email",
"oidcngInfo": "<p>email</p> <p>Description: e-mail address; syntax in accordance with RFC 5322.</p>"
}
},
"urns": [
Expand All @@ -78,10 +78,10 @@
"id": "organization",
"translations" : {
"en": {
"saml20Label": "Organization att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Organization att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Label": "Home organization attribute",
"saml20Info": "<p>urn:mace: urn:mace:terena.org:attribute-def:schacHomeOrganization<br /> urn:oid: urn:oid:1.3.6.1.4.1.25178.1.2.9</p><p>Description: the user's organization using the organization's domain name; syntax in accordance with RFC 1035.</p>",
"oidcngLabel": "schac_home_organization",
"oidcngInfo": "<p>schac_home_organization</p> <p>Description: the user's organization using the organization's domain name; syntax in accordance with RFC 1035.</p>"
}
},
"urns": [
Expand All @@ -93,10 +93,10 @@
"id": "organizationType",
"translations" : {
"en": {
"saml20Label": "Organization type att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Organization type att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Label": "Organization type attribute",
"saml20Info": "<p>urn:mace: <a href='https://wiki.refeds.org/display/STAN/SCHAC+Releases' target='_blank'>urn:mace:terena.org:attribute-def:schacHomeOrganizationType</a><br />urn:oid: <a href='http://oid-info.com/get/1.3.6.1.4.1.25178.1.2.10' target='_blank'>urn:oid:1.3.6.1.4.1.25178.1.2.10</a></p> <p>Description: designation of the type of organisation as defined on<a href='https://wiki.refeds.org/display/STAN/SCHAC+Releases' target='_blank'> https://wiki.refeds.org/display/STAN/SCHAC+Releases</a></p>",
"oidcngLabel": "schac_home_organization_type",
"oidcngInfo": "<p>schac_home_organization_type</p> <p>Description: designation of the type of organisation as defined on <a href='https://wiki.refeds.org/display/STAN/SCHAC+Releases' target='_blank'> https://wiki.refeds.org/display/STAN/SCHAC+Releases </a>.</p>"
}
},
"urns": [
Expand All @@ -109,9 +109,9 @@
"translations" : {
"en": {
"saml20Label": "Organization unit att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Organization unit att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>urn:mace:dir:attribute-def:ou</p> <p> indicates the department, team, or faculty with which the user is associated within the issuing institution. This attribute is multi-valued, so multiple departments, teams or faculties can be listed For example: <ul> <li>ICT Services </li> <li>Industrial Engineering & Innovation Science </li> <li>Facility Management Center </li> </ul> </p>",
"oidcngLabel": "ou",
"oidcngInfo": "<p>OrganizationalUnitName</p> <p>Description: indicates the department, team, or faculty with which the user is associated within the issuing institution. This attribute is multi-valued, so multiple departments, teams or faculties can be listed, for example: <ul> <li>ICT Services </li> <li>Industrial Engineering & Innovation Science </li> <li>Facility Management Center </li> </ul></p>"
}
},
"urns": [
Expand All @@ -124,9 +124,9 @@
"translations" : {
"en": {
"saml20Label": "Affiliation att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Affiliation att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>urn:mace: <a href='https://wiki.refeds.org/display/STAN/eduPerson+2021-11' target='_blank'>urn:mace:dir:attribute-def:eduPersonAffiliation<br /></a>urn:oid: <a href='http://oid-info.com/get/1.3.6.1.4.1.5923.1.1.1.1' target='_blank'>urn:oid:1.3.6.1.4.1.5923.1.1.1.1</a></p> <p>Description: indicates the relationship between the user and his home organisation. The following values are permitted:</p> <ul> <li>student - student</li> <li>employee - all employees</li> <li>staff - academic staff</li> <li>member - Anyone that holds at least one of the above affiliations is also a member</li> <li>faculty - primary role is teaching or research</li> <li>pre-student - registered but not yet a full student</li> <li>affiliate - A person who is authorised by the Institution to use the service</li></ul>",
"oidcngLabel": "eduperson_affiliation",
"oidcngInfo": "<p>eduperson_affiliation</p><br> <p>Description: indicates the relationship between the user and his home organisation. The following values are permitted:</p> <ul> <li>student - student</li> <li>employee - all employees</li> <li>staff - academic staff</li> <li>member - Anyone that holds at least one of the above affiliations is also a member</li> <li>faculty - primary role is teaching or research</li> <li>pre-student - registered but not yet a full student</li> <li>affiliate - A person who is authorised by the Institution to use the service</li></ul"
}
},
"urns": [
Expand All @@ -139,9 +139,9 @@
"translations" : {
"en": {
"saml20Label": "Entitlement att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Entitlement att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>urn:mace: <a href='https://wiki.refeds.org/display/STAN/eduPerson+2021-11' target='_blank'>urn:mace:dir:attribute-def:eduPersonEntitlement<br /></a>urn:oid: <a href='http://oid-info.com/get/1.3.6.1.4.1.5923.1.1.1.7' target='_blank'>urn:oid:1.3.6.1.4.1.5923.1.1.1.7</a></p> <p>Description: custom URI (URL or URN) that indicates an entitlement to something.</p>",
"oidcngLabel": "eduperson_entitlement",
"oidcngInfo": "<p>eduperson_entitlement</p> <p>Description: custom URI (URL or URN) that indicates an entitlement to something.</p>"
}
},
"urns": [
Expand All @@ -153,10 +153,10 @@
"id": "principleName",
"translations" : {
"en": {
"saml20Label": "Principle name att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Principle name att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Label": "Principle name attribute (EPPN)",
"saml20Info": "<p>urn:mace: <a href='https://wiki.refeds.org/display/STAN/eduPerson+2021-11' target='_blank'>urn:mace:dir:attribute-def:eduPersonPrincipalName<br /></a>urn:oid: <a href='http://oid-info.com/get/1.3.6.1.4.1.5923.1.1.1.6' target='_blank'>urn:oid:1.3.6.1.4.1.5923.1.1.1.6</a></p> <p>Description: unique identifier for a user.</p>",
"oidcngLabel": "eduperson_principal_name",
"oidcngInfo": "<p>eduperson_principal_name</p><p>Description: unique identifier for a user.</p>"
}
},
"urns": [
Expand All @@ -169,9 +169,9 @@
"translations" : {
"en": {
"saml20Label": "Uid att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Uid att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>urn:mace: <a href='https://wiki.refeds.org/display/STAN/eduPerson+2021-11' target='_blank'>urn:mace:dir:attribute-def:uid</a><br />urn:oid: <a href='http://oid-info.com/get/1.3.6.1.4.1.1466.115.121.1.15' target='_blank'>urn:oid:0.9.2342.19200300.100.1.1</a></p> <p>Description: the unique code for a person that is used as the login name within the institution.</p>",
"oidcngLabel": "uids",
"oidcngInfo": "<p>uids</p><p>Description: the unique code within the institution for a person that is used as the login name.</p>"
}
},
"urns": [
Expand All @@ -184,9 +184,9 @@
"translations" : {
"en": {
"saml20Label": "Preferred language att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Preferred language att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>urn:mace: urn:mace:dir:attribute-def:preferredLanguage<br />urn:oid: urn:oid:2.16.840.1.113730.3.1.39 </p> <p>Description: a two-letter abbreviation for the preferred language according to the ISO 639 language abbreviation code table; no subcodes</p>",
"oidcngLabel": "locale",
"oidcngInfo": "<p>locale</p> <p> Description: a two-letter abbreviation for the preferred language according to the ISO 639 language abbreviation code table; no subcodes.</p>"
}
},
"urns": [
Expand All @@ -198,10 +198,10 @@
"id": "personalCode",
"translations" : {
"en": {
"saml20Label": "Personal code att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Personal code att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Label": "Employee-student number attribute",
"saml20Info": "<p>urn:mace: urn:schac:attribute-def:schacPersonalUniqueCode <br />urn:oid: urn:oid:1.3.6.1.4.1.25178.1.2.14 </p> <p>Description: The user's student, employee, and/or member id as used in the institution's internal systems. More information: <a href='https://wiki.surfnet.nl/pages/viewpage.action?pageId=11207351'> https://wiki.surfnet.nl/pages/viewpage.action?pageId=11207351</a> </p>",
"oidcngLabel": "schac_personal_unique_code",
"oidcngInfo": "<p>schac_personal_unique_code</p> <p>Description: The user's student, employee, and/or member id as used in the institution's internal systems. More information: <a href='https://wiki.surfnet.nl/pages/viewpage.action?pageId=11207351' target='_blank'> https://wiki.surfnet.nl/pages/viewpage.action?pageId=11207351</a></p>"
}
},
"urns": [
Expand All @@ -214,9 +214,9 @@
"translations" : {
"en": {
"saml20Label": "Scoped affiliation att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Scoped affiliation att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Info": "<p>urn:mace: urn:mace:dir:attribute-def:eduPersonScopedAffiliation<br />urn:oid: urn:oid:1.3.6.1.4.1.5923.1.1.1.9</p> <p>Description: Indicates the relationship between the user and a specific (security) domain with his home organisation. The following values are permitted: <ul> <li> student - student </li> <li> employee - all employees </li> <li> staff - academic staff </li> <li> member - anyone that holds at least one of the above affiliations is also a member </li></ul></p>",
"oidcngLabel": "eduperson_scoped_affiliation",
"oidcngInfo": "<p>eduperson_scoped_affiliation</p> <p>Description: Indicates the relationship between the user and a specific (security) domain with his home organisation. The following values are permitted: <ul> <li> student - student </li> <li> employee - all employees </li> <li> staff - academic staff </li> <li> member - anyone that holds at least one of the above affiliations is also a member </li></ul></p>"
}
},
"urns": [
Expand All @@ -231,30 +231,15 @@
],
"translations" : {
"en": {
"saml20Label": "Edu person targeted ID attribute",
"saml20Info": "Text should be set in web translations",
"oidcngLabel": "Edu person targeted ID attribute",
"oidcngInfo": "Text should be set in web translations"
"saml20Label": "EduPerson targeted ID attribute",
"saml20Info": "<p>urn:mace:dir:attribute-def:eduPersonTargetedID<br />urn:oid:1.3.6.1.4.1.5923.1.1.1.10</p> <p>This attribute is created because the Subject NameID itself is not part of the SAML v2.0 response and therefore only is available for application if the local SAML implementation explicitly support this. Within SURFconext the Subject 'NameID' is explicitly copied into the eduPersonTargetedID attribute, in order for the identifier to be used like any other attribute.</p>",
"oidcngLabel": "not used in OIDC",
"oidcngInfo": "not used in OIDC"
}
},
"urns": [
"urn:mace:dir:attribute-def:eduPersonTargetedID",
"urn:oid:1.3.6.1.4.1.5923.1.1.1.10"
]
},
{
"id": "contactPersonID",
"translations" : {
"en": {
"saml20Label": "Saml20 Contact Person target ID attribute",
"saml20Info": "Saml20 Text should be set in web translations",
"oidcngLabel": "Oidcng Contact Person target ID attribute",
"oidcngInfo": "Oidcng Text should be set in web translations"
}
},
"urns": [
"urn:mace:dir:attribute-def:contactPersonIDID",
"urn:oid:1.3.6.1.4.1.5923.1.1.1.100"
]
}
]

0 comments on commit 1734b96

Please sign in to comment.